Galvalume PlusGalvalume Plus™™ SteelSteel

AZM-180 Galvalume Plus™ is made from a steel sheet product. The steel is highly corrosion resistant due to its hot dipped aluminum zinc alloy coating.The end result is a building that is superior in strength, 7 times more rust resistant than galvanized steel, excellent heat reflectivity (5-8 degrees cooler in warm climates), and a 30 year rust perforation warranty.

Al-Zn Coating vs. Hot-Dip GalvanizedAl-Zn Coating vs. Hot-Dip Galvanized

To resist corrosion initiated at panel bends and damage sites, 55% Al-Zn coated steel is a better choice of substrate for prepainting

Corrosion performance at buildings in rural/acid rain Ontario:Hot-dip galvanized after 21 years; 55% Al-Zn coating after 17.5 years.

Do-It-Yourself AssemblyDo-It-Yourself AssemblyAssembly is easy and requires only a small group of laborers and a few simple tools:

1. Pour the footings.

2. Assemble the arches on the ground.

3. Raise the arches using only ropes and scaffolding in most cases.

4. Insert end-walls and accessories.

Strength of DesignStrength of Design

Future Steel Buildings features a 100% truss-free design which requires no structural members. This provides the customer with more versatility and unmatched ease of construction.

The strength of the building can be found in:

1. the arch style design; 2. the corrugated arches; 3. varying steel gauges from 22-14; 4. vertical and horizontal overlaps of 3” and 9” respectively.

Strength of Design Strength of Design (continued)(continued)

Every Future Steel building ensures a 9” overlap on every arch panel. In addition, we also ensure that all overlaps and bolt surfaces are completely flat.

This feature eliminates the need to caulk panels and prevents leaking.

9” overlap

Strength of Design Strength of Design (continued)(continued)

Heat reflectivity: Galvalume Plus steel offers excellent solar reflectivity and heat resistance which will help to naturally cool building interiors, and therefore, reduce energy costs.

Strength of Design Strength of Design (continued)(continued)

Minimal concrete: Our floating foundation consists of only a 4” thick floor and a 10” wide footer that extends 18” deep. The minimal use of concrete in our design will help to keep the overall project cost as affordable as possible.

Strength of Design Strength of Design (continued)(continued)

Ease of construction:Future Steel Buildings is well-known for its do-it-yourself assembly process. Most of our buildings are erected without the help of on-site engineers or skilled construction workers. This will allow for affordable local labourers to be hired, rather than expensive skilled professionals. In addition, our buildings can be taken apart and relocated if they are meant for temporary purposes only.

Strength of Design Strength of Design (continued)(continued)

Warranty: Future Steel Buildings only uses the highest quality Galvalume Plus steel in the industry which provides at least twice the corrosion resistance of traditional galvanized coatings of similar thicknesses. As a result, every building will come with a 30 year limited warranty against rust perforation that will guarantee an extremely long term investment.

EngineeringEngineering

All Future Steel buildings are designed and manufactured in accordance with local governing building codes. They will meet live, snow, wind and seismic loading requirements to name a few.

Every building purchase will include at least 3 sets of certified engineered drawings and a construction manual.

Engineering Engineering (continued)(continued)

Future Steel Buildings has received CAN/CSA A660-04 certification which ensures the highest standards in design, engineering, manufacturing, quality control and much more.

CAN/CSA A660-04 certification is required by the National Building Code of Canada for all steel building manufacturers in Canada, and is one of the most stringent certifications in the world.

ShippingShippingAll Future Steel Buildings feature standard panel components which stack neatly and easily to dramatically reduce the bulk-cargo and freight cost per square meter of traditional building shipping.

For example, a 40’ container will fit approximately 4 buildings at 10m x 15m with an average amount of accessories.
